- Her name is spelled with the character 濵 for "Hama", but since this character can display differently on different computer operating systems, on many mobile sites and media images it is written using the more common character 浜 instead.
- Also, Japanese names with 4 characters are usually split into 2 characters for family name and 2 characters for first name (e.g. 前田敦子 Maeda Atsuko: 前田 is Maeda, 敦子 is Atsuko). It is rather unusual to have a 4-character name where only 1 character represents the family name (濵) and 3 characters represent the first name (咲友菜). More commonly, families with a 1-character last name tend to use 2-character first name so it's easier to read (e.g. 沖侑果 Oki Yuka: 沖 is Oki, 侑果 is Yuka).
- She auditioned for Team 8 after her father reminded her that she had declared that she wanted to be an idol when she graduated from nursery school.
- Because of her small size and her childlike personality, she is known as Team 8's "little sister". She is known for being bright and cheerful with everyone.
- One of her hobbies is metal welding. She first experienced welding using an AR simulator at a vocational training event in Kusatsu City in November 2019. She found it fun, and after practicing she obtained her Arc Welding Special Education Certificate in September 2020.
- She was diagnosed with coronavirus on December 26, 2020, and resumed activities on January 3, 2021.
- In April 2021 she began appearing as a regular in Biwako Broadcasting's "Friday Omoro Shiga".
- She is a fan of the Shiga Prefecture basketball team Shiga Lakes. She has done promotional work with Shiga Lakes players.
- On AKB48 Sayonara Mouri-san, revealed welding as one of her unusual interests. Her father works at a factory where she likes to help out. It is considered to be very physically challenging.
History
2014
- On April 3rd, was announced as a member of AKB48's Team 8.
- On June 24th, had her first appearance on AKBINGO!. She was one of 15 selected Team 8 members to perform Koi Suru Juuden Prius with Sashihara Rino.
- On July 29th, was one of 16 selected members to perform 47 no Suteki na Machi e on AKBINGO!.
- On August 5th, had her theater debut with Team 8's 1st stage, PARTY ga Hajimaru yo at the SKE48 theater.
- On October 11th and 25th, was one of 16 selected members to perform a medley on the AKB48 SHOW!.
2015
- On October 16th, was part of the shonichi performance for AKB48's 3rd special stage, Dounaru?! Dousuru?! AKB48.
- On November 14th, was part of the shonichi performance for Team 8's 2nd stage, Aitakatta.
2017
- On December 8th, at the AKB48 12th Anniversary Shuffle, received a kennin position in Murayama Team 4.
2019
- On September 24th, was part of the final episode of AKBINGO!.
2020
- On December 26th, was confirmed to have contracted COVID-19 and went on a hiatus.
2021
- On January 2nd, was confirmed to have recovered.
- On January 3rd, resumed her activities.
- On December 8th, at the AKB48 16th Anniversary Team Shuffle, it was announced her kennin position would be transferred to Taguchi Team K.
2022
- On January 31st, appeared in the BUBKA magazine alongside Asai Nanami, Omori Miyuu, Kubo Satone, Kuranoo Narumi, Taguchi Manaka and Mukaichi Mion.
- On April 4th, was part of the senshuuraku performance for Team 4's Te wo Tsunaginagara stage.
- On April 19th, officially became a member of Taguchi Team K.
- On July 22nd, appeared on AKB48 Sayonara Mouri-san (AKB48サヨナラ毛利さん) for the first time.
2023
- On February 4th, announced her graduation.
- On April 30th, graduated from AKB48.
